The Team:

The Statewide Operational Planning Unit (SOPU) was established in late-2023 with a primary focus of supporting operational business units as a centralised platform. With core functions including roster maintenance, recruitment, leave planning and establishment management, the SOPU will deliver statewide oversight and consistency for all strategies ensuring efficiency and alignment with operational needs

The Role:

Provide quality 7- day rostering services and business support to the unit manager, including liaising with frontline staff, managers and relevant industrial representatives.

  • Contribute to the preparation and maintenance of rosters for the Operational business units, including entering leave data and, staff absences
  • Assist in ensuring roster projections are in line with Ambulance Tasmania Award rostering provisions.
  • Provide assistance to Operational business units by supporting tasks such as rostering, updating establishments, and assisting with recruitment as required.
  • Maintain communication and collaboration with managers and supervisors to ensure that operational business needs and issues are communicated proactively and in a timely manner.
  • Add Manage incoming phone calls, accurately record absences of the front-line staff, and update Daily Alternations accordingly.

Details of appointment:

Permanent full time shift worker position, working 76 hours per fortnight, commencing as soon as possible.

*Notwithstanding hours to be negotiated with the successful applicant.

Applicants should note that, for a period of twelve months from the date of publication, this selection process may be used to fill subsequent or similar full time, part time, and casual vacancies.

Salary: $73,811 to $79,779 per annum. Our Employer 12% superannuation contribution is on top of this amount.

  • Salary range is in accordance with Public Sector Unions Wages Agreement 2022.
